WebThe coefficient of relationship is a measure of the degree of consanguinity (or biological relationship) between two individuals. The term coefficient of relationship was defined by Sewall Wright in 1922, and was derived from his definition of the coefficient of inbreeding of 1921. WebNov 8, 2024 · Coefficient of inbreeding ( F) represents probability that two alleles on a loci are identical by descent (Wright, 1922; Falconer and Mackay, 1996).
